During a recent vacation abroad, All My Children vet Denise Vasi became engaged to beau Anthony Mandler. Vasi, who appeared on AMC for more than three years, currently stars in VH1's Single Ladies.

Congratulations goes out to All My Children's Denise Vasi (Randi Hubbard). The actress is off the market -- she recently became engaged during a vacation to Greece with her boyfriend, music video director Anthony Mandler.

"What an amazing moment for us! Loving all the beautiful words," Vasi posted on Twitter, along with photos of her now-glimmery ring finger. "NOW the fun part... #weddingplanning."

Vasi appeared on All My Children from 2008 through the series' final episode in September 2011. She currently appears in the second season of VH1's Single Ladies. Vasi plays Raquel, a businesswoman from a prominent Southern family who has been looking for a change in her life.

Mandler has directed videos for artists such as Jay Z, Rihanna, and Usher.
